Book your tickets online for the Music Box Museum exhibition in Nagoya City, Aichi Prefecture. Explore the history of self-playing musical instruments with demonstrations and explanations of various automatic musical instruments and automata (automatic dolls). Experience a special exhibition featuring the world's oldest music box, crafted in Switzerland in 1796.
